Optimized moodle variable names

This commit is contained in:
2025-07-17 06:38:51 +02:00
parent 725fea1169
commit 529efc0bd7
7 changed files with 22 additions and 20 deletions

View File

@@ -1,5 +1,5 @@
- name: Check if config.php exists
command: docker exec --user root {{ moodle_name }} test -f {{ moodle_config }}
command: docker exec --user root {{ moodle_container }} test -f {{ moodle_config }}
register: config_file_exists
changed_when: false
failed_when: false
@@ -15,10 +15,10 @@
- name: Copy config.php from container to host
command: >
docker cp {{ moodle_name }}:{{ moodle_config }} /opt/docker/moodle/_backup/config.php.bak
docker cp {{ moodle_container }}:{{ moodle_config }} /opt/docker/moodle/_backup/config.php.bak
- name: Check if config.php exists
command: docker exec --user root {{ moodle_name }} test -f {{ moodle_config }}
command: docker exec --user root {{ moodle_container }} test -f {{ moodle_config }}
register: config_file_exists
changed_when: false
failed_when: false
@@ -28,20 +28,20 @@
block:
- name: Update DB host
command: >
docker exec --user root {{ moodle_name }}
docker exec --user root {{ moodle_container }}
sed -i "s/^\$CFG->dbhost *= *.*/\$CFG->dbhost = '{{ database_host }}';/" {{ moodle_config }}
- name: Update DB name
command: >
docker exec --user root {{ moodle_name }}
docker exec --user root {{ moodle_container }}
sed -i "s/^\$CFG->dbname *= *.*/\$CFG->dbname = '{{ database_name }}';/" {{ moodle_config }}
- name: Update DB user
command: >
docker exec --user root {{ moodle_name }}
docker exec --user root {{ moodle_container }}
sed -i "s/^\$CFG->dbuser *= *.*/\$CFG->dbuser = '{{ database_username }}';/" {{ moodle_config }}
- name: Update DB password
command: >
docker exec --user root {{ moodle_name }}
docker exec --user root {{ moodle_container }}
sed -i "s/^\$CFG->dbpass *= *.*/\$CFG->dbpass = '{{ database_password }}';/" {{ moodle_config }}